i'm trying to import HD footage into final cut express, but when i do it, the quality gets really bad. anybody knows how to solve his?
MikkelMovieMaker 10 months ago 14
@MikkelMovieMaker
When you load up final cut express click on final cut express. Then select easy setup, choose hd and then select the format you would like it to be in. Do all this before you put your footage into final cut express and this should keep the footage hd. Hope this helped !

@MikkelMovieMaker I had a problem with that for a long time, and im like what the heck. i play it in iphoto and its HD but in FC its SD,
I just figured it out this past weekend, Basically right click the Sequence 1--> Settings--> Load Sequence Preset (in bottom left)--> go to the drop down and its One of the Apple Intermediate Codec 1080i 1920x1080. To figure out what your video actually is --> right click any of your videos and go to info or settings.

Is the canon 60D automatically compatible with final cut express? Or do you have to do some converting? I just bought the canon 60D and im still waiting for it to come in and i dont know anything about this stuff. can you please help me out?
punkwaste69 11 months ago
@punkwaste69 as with all DSLR's, you gotta convert it to an easier editable codec, I just use mpeg streamclip, a free converter to convert my files. then import them into final cut
